BASEES 2023 Annual Conference, University of Glasgow, 31 March – 2 April 2023
The British Association for Slavonic and East European Studies (BASEES) invites proposals for panels and roundtables, and papers for its 2023 annual conference. We plan to hold BASEES 2023 in-person from the 31st of March to the 2nd of April, which will be hosted at the University of Glasgow, United Kingdom, a leading international centre for the study of Central and Eastern Europe and home to the journal Europe-Asia Studies (https://www.gla.ac.uk/schools/socialpolitical/research/cees/). The conference will also welcome remote attendees. The 2022 conference welcomed over 500 delegates from over 40 countries around the world.
The deadline for paper and panel/roundtable proposals is Friday, 30 September 2022. To propose a panel or a paper you will need to fill in the electronic proposal form on this website. The submission platform will open in late July at www.baseesconference.org
BASEES welcomes paper, panel and roundtable proposals in the following areas: Politics; History; Sociology and Geography; Film and Media, Languages and Linguistics; Literatures and Cultures; and Economics. In the context of Russia’s war against Ukraine, we particularly welcome proposals that help to push forward the work to decentralise and decolonise the study of the former ‘communist bloc’ of the Soviet Union, Central and Eastern Europe and Asia. The conference especially welcomes participation by postgraduate research students and early career scholars.
Remote attendance:
BASEES is welcoming remote paper presentations and panels that include remote attendees. If you wish to attend remotely, please indicate so when submitting your proposal. However, we cannot accept fully remote panels. The Chair of a panel, who can also be one of the presenters, must attend the conference in-person to lead the session and facilitate the Q&A.

BASEES 2023 Child Policy
BASEES is committed to enabling members with young children who cannot make alternative arrangements to bring them to the conference. Click here to view the BASEES 2023 Child Policy.
Attendees who are members of BASEES or are joining BASEES and who require assistance with childcare during the annual conference may apply for financial support. If your application is accepted, you will be provided a small grant towards the costs of childcare during BASEES 2023 to support your participation in the conference. Anti-harassment policy
The British Association for Slavonic and East European Studies is dedicated to providing a harassment-free conference experience for everyone regardless of gender, sexual orientation, disability, physical appearance, body size, nationality, citizenship, race, or religion. We do not tolerate harassment of participants or staff in any form.
